Here's my homemade cleaning station!

One 4 pint milk jug, some kitty litter, a filter & the AB holder often supplied with eBay kit.

I cut a hole in the jug, epoxied the holder in place, filled it up 1/3 with kitty litter & used some paintbooth glassfibre filter material in the tube at the top.

So far it works really well, no fumes whilst cleaning & all the fluids are soaked up by the litter.

If anyone copies this, wet the litter a little before first use or it flies all round inside the jug!
